ABOUT: BERNESE MOUNTAIN DOG DOG BREED
The Bernese Mountain Dog, originating from Switzerland, is a large and sturdy working breed known for its gentle nature and impressive strength. These dogs have striking tri color coats of black, white, and rust, with a thick double coat that provides protection in cold weather. Bernese Mountain Dogs are loyal, affectionate family companions, known for their calm temperament and love for children. While they require regular grooming and exercise, their loving nature and devotion make them a beloved breed for families seeking a loyal and affectionate canine companion.
The Golden Retriever is a friendly, intelligent, and gentle dog breed known for its golden colored, water repellent coat. They are highly sociable and great with families, children, and other pets, making them popular as therapy and service dogs. With a love for outdoor activities and water, Golden Retrievers excel in various dog sports like agility and obedience. They require regular exercise, mental stimulation, and grooming to maintain their health and happiness. Overall, the Golden Retriever is a versatile and beloved companion dog breed.
